乐趣区

深入解析Vue项目中的常见错误及其解决方法

标题:深入解析 Vue 项目中的常见错误及其解决方法

在开发 Vue 项目的过程中,由于各种原因可能会遇到一些常见的错误。这些错误可能涉及到 Vue 版本的问题、组件的使用问题以及前端和后端的集成问题等。下面将详细阐述这些问题及其相应的解决方法。

  1. Vue 版本不兼容
    在开发过程中,如果当前使用的 Vue 版本与项目的构建脚本(如 Webpack)不符,则可能会出现错误。首先,需要检查项目中的 package.json 文件中对 vue-loaderterser-loader的配置是否正确,确保它们是最新版或与其对应版本相匹配。其次,可以使用命令行工具(如 Vue CLI、Vue Devtools 等)来检测并修正不兼容的问题。

  2. 前端组件与后端接口之间的集成
    如果前端开发人员编写了与后端 API 交互的代码但没有正确地配置,可能会出现各种问题。首先,确保在 app.vue 中定义一个全局的路由对象,并使用 router.push() 来跳转到对应的组件。其次,需要检查是否所有涉及数据请求和响应的数据传输都在同一个组件内完成。此外,还需关注后端 API 的错误处理策略。

  3. Vue 组件内部生命周期钩子
    在 Vue 中,某些生命周期钩子可能会影响组件的行为,但未得到正确使用或设置不当可能会导致问题。首先,需要检查所有使用 created()mounted()beforeMount()update()beforeUpdate()等方法的代码是否使用得当。其次,确保这些钩子在 Vue 实例创建完成之后立即调用。最后,可以使用调试工具来进一步诊断可能的问题。

  4. 前端组件的错误处理
    前端开发人员需要对用户输入数据进行验证,并根据实际情况编写错误处理逻辑,以便在发生错误时提供适当的信息。首先,确保所有输入字段都设置了 required 属性。其次,检查路由和中间件是否正确地进行了错误处理。最后,可以使用 Vue 的 <v-error /> 组件来为错误信息添加样式。

  5. 配置文件配置不当
    配置文件通常用于存储项目中的公共设置、路由规则等。如果这些配置没有被正确地应用到项目中或存在语法错误,则可能导致无法正常运行的问题。首先,检查所有的配置文件(如 config/index.jssrc/main.js)是否包含正确的模块引用和全局变量。其次,确保配置文件的格式正确无误。

  6. 优化策略
    在开发过程中,应关注性能优化以减少响应时间。这包括但不限于代码压缩、使用 CDN 等方式来减少资源加载时间,以及使用 Vue 的 VModel 或 v -for 来提高效率等。

  7. 防止错误的复现和重现
    为了确保其他开发者能够在遇到问题时能迅速且准确地诊断出原因并解决问题,应编写详尽的日志记录和错误堆栈跟踪。此外,可以创建一个测试环境并在其中运行测试用例以确认解决方案的有效性。

  8. 持续学习与实践
    开发 Vue 项目是一项持续的过程,需要不断学习新的技术知识,并且通过实践来积累经验。因此,应保持对 Vue 的密切关注以及相关的工具和技术的关注,以便在遇到问题时能够迅速找到解决方案。

总结来说,处理 Vue 项目的常见错误需要仔细规划和周密考虑。只有这样,才能确保开发过程中的顺畅进行和项目的质量提高。

退出移动版